The Harvard Boys Do Russia
After vii years of economical “reform” financed yesteryear billions of dollars inwards U.S.A. of America as well as other Western aid, subsidized loans as well as rescheduled debt, the bulk of Russian people discovery themselves worse off economically. The privatization crusade that was supposed to reap the fruits of the gratis marketplace position instead helped to create a arrangement of tycoon capitalism run for the arrive at goodness of a corrupt political oligarchy that has appropriated hundreds of millions of dollars of Western assistance as well as plundered Russia’s wealth.

The architect of privatization was quondam First Deputy Prime Minister Anatoly Chubais, a darling of the U.S.A. of America as well as Western fiscal establishments. Chubais’s drastic as well as corrupt stewardship made him extremely unpopular. According to The New York Times, he “may survive the almost despised human inwards Russia.”

Essential to the implementation of Chubais’s policies was the enthusiastic back upwards of the Clinton Administration as well as its cardinal instance for economical assistance inwards Moscow, the Harvard Institute for International Development. Using the prestige of Harvard’s cite as well as connections inwards the Administration, H.I.I.D. officials acquired virtual carte blanche over the U.S.A. of America economical assistance programme to Russia, alongside minimal oversight yesteryear the regime agencies involved. With this access as well as their closed alliance alongside Chubais as well as his circle, they allegedly profited on the side. Yet few Americans are aware of H.I.I.D.’s purpose inwards Russian privatization, as well as its suspected misuse of taxpayers’ funds.
At the recent U.S.-Russian Investment Symposium at Harvard’s John F. Kennedy School of Government, Yuri Luzhkov, the Mayor of Moscow, made what mightiness bring seemed to many an impolite reference to his hosts. After castigating Chubais as well as his monetarist policies, Luzhkov, according to a study of the event, “singled out Harvard for the terms inflicted on the Russian economic scheme yesteryear its advisers, who encouraged Chubais’s misguided approach to privatization as well as monetarism.” Luzhkov was referring to H.I.I.D. Chubais, who was delegated vast powers over the economic scheme yesteryear Boris Yeltsin, was ousted inwards Yeltsin’s March purge, only inwards May he was given an immensely lucrative post every bit caput of Unified Energy System, the country’s electricity monopoly. Some of the master copy actors alongside Harvard’s Russian Federation projection bring yet to confront a reckoning, only this may alter if a electrical flow investigation yesteryear the U.S.A. of America regime results inwards prosecutions.

The activities of H.I.I.D. inwards Russian Federation furnish about cautionary lessons on abuse of trust yesteryear supposedly disinterested unusual advisers, on U.S.A. of America arrogance as well as on the entire policy of back upwards for a unmarried Russian grouping of so-called reformers. The H.I.I.D. even is a familiar i inwards the ongoing saga of U.S.A. of America unusual policy disasters created yesteryear those said to survive our “best as well as brightest.”

Through the belatedly summertime as well as autumn of 1991, every bit the Soviet province cruel apart, Harvard Professor Jeffrey Sachs as well as other Western economists participated inwards meetings at a dacha exterior Moscow where young, pro-Yeltsin reformers planned Russia’s economical as well as political future. Sachs teamed upwards alongside Yegor Gaidar, Yeltsin’s start architect of economical reform, to promote a innovation of “shock therapy” to swiftly eliminate almost of the cost controls as well as subsidies that had underpinned life for Soviet citizens for decades. Shock therapy produced to a greater extent than shock–not least, hyperinflation that hitting 2,500 percent–than therapy. One outcome was the evaporation of much potential investment capital: the substantial savings of Russians. By Nov 1992, Gaidar was nether assault for his failed policies as well as was shortly pushed aside. When Gaidar came nether seige, Sachs wrote a memo to i of Gaidar’s principal opponents, Ruslan Khasbulatov, Speaker of the Supreme Soviet, as well as so the Russian parliament, offering advice as well as to assist adjust Western assistance as well as contacts inwards the U.S.A. of America Congress.

Enter Anatoly Chubais, a smooth, 42-year-old English-speaking would-be capitalist who became Yeltsin’s economical czar. Chubais, committed to “radical reform,” vowed to build a marketplace position economic scheme as well as sweep away the vestiges of Communism. The U.S.A. of America Agency for International Development (U.S.A.I.D.), without sense inwards the quondam Soviet Union, was readily persuaded to mitt over the responsibleness for reshaping the Russian economic scheme to H.I.I.D., which was founded inwards 1974 to assist countries alongside social as well as economical reform.

H.I.I.D. had supporters high inwards the Administration. One was Lawrence Summers, himself a quondam Harvard economic science professor, whom Clinton named Under Secretary of the Treasury for International Affairs inwards 1993. Summers, at i time Deputy Treasury Secretary, had longstanding ties to the principals of Harvard’s projection inwards Russian Federation as well as its afterwards projection inwards Ukraine.

Summers hired a Harvard Ph.D., David Lipton (who had been vice president of Jeffrey D. Sachs as well as Associates, a consulting firm), to survive Deputy Assistant Treasury Secretary for Eastern Europe as well as the Former Soviet Union. After Summers was promoted to Deputy Secretary, Lipton moved into Summers’s old job, assuming “broad responsibility” for all aspects of international economical policy development. Lipton co-wrote numerous papers alongside Sachs as well as served alongside him on consulting missions inwards Poland as well as Russia. “Jeff as well as David ever came [to Russia] together,” said a Russian instance at the International Monetary Fund. “They were similar an inseparable couple.” Sachs, who was named manager of H.I.I.D. inwards 1995, lobbied for as well as received U.S.A.I.D. grants for the institute to operate inwards Ukraine inwards 1996 as well as 1997.

Andrei Shleifer, a Russian-born émigré as well as already a tenured professor of economic science at Harvard inwards his early on 30s, became manager of H.I.I.D.’s Russian Federation project. Shleifer was besides a protégé of Summers, alongside whom he received at to the lowest degree i foundation grant. Summers wrote a promotional blurb for Privatizing Russia (a 1995 bulk co-written yesteryear Shleifer as well as subsidized yesteryear H.I.I.D.) declaring that “the authors did remarkable things inwards Russia, as well as at i time they bring written a remarkable book.”

Another Harvard instrumentalist was a quondam World Bank consultant named Jonathan Hay, a Rhodes scholar who had attended Moscow’s Pushkin Institute for Russian Language. In 1991, piece yet at Harvard Law School, he had move a senior legal adviser to the G.K.I., the Russian state’s novel privatization committee; the next twelvemonth he was made H.I.I.D.’s full general manager inwards Moscow.
